Frank Fritz, “American Pickers” star, dead at 60 — rest in peace

Frank Fritz, the beloved star of *American Pickers*, has died at 60, leaving fans heartbroken. Fritz, who left the show in 2021 due to health issues, had suffered a stroke in 2022. His passing was announced by longtime friend and co-star Mike Wolfe, who paid tribute on social media, calling Fritz a “dreamer” with a big heart. The duo gained fame by exploring America’s garages and barns, unearthing valuable antiques. Fritz’s charm and partnership with Wolfe made the show a hit.
